Chickenpox usually occurs in … Webb25 mars 2024 · Some of the most common bugs that look like ticks are mites and chiggers. Others include fleas, flea beetles, cabbage bugs, stink bugs, and carpet beetles. Mites and chiggers are the most convincing since ticks, mites, and chiggers all have eight legs and are very small. They are all closely related and belong to the arachnid family. soft vinyl flooring pricelist

A vector-borne disease is one transmitted through an insect bite, in this case, ticks infected with a bacterium called Borrelia burgdorferi.Most patients do not recall any tick bite, and they only display an array of signs and symptoms … Webb10 apr. 2024 · A tick bite can cause a meat allergy. Along with possibly getting sick as a result of a tick’s feasting on your body, you could, if bitten by the lone star variety, potentially develop an allergy to red meat (also known as alpha-gal syndrome ). This is due to a type of sugar molecule, called alpha-gal, that’s transmitted during the tick’s mealtime. WebbAre the mouthparts long, narrow and visible from above the tick?
